What companies run services between Huangshan North Station, China and Beijing, China?

Air China flies from Huangshan Airport (TXN) to Beijing Capital International Airport (PEK) 4 times a week. Alternatively, China Railways G-Class operates a train from Huangshan North to Beijing South every 4 hours. Tickets cost ¥570–630 and the journey takes 5h 5m.
